Understanding IGF1 LR3: A Comprehensive Guide

Insulin-Like Growth Factor 1 Long R3 (IGF1 LR3) is a synthetic protein known for its potent anabolic properties. With enhanced biological effects, it is crucial in muscle growth and cellular repair research. Unlike regular IGF-1, LR3 variant resists binding to inhibitory proteins, prolonging efficacy and facilitating more effective interaction with cell receptors. This modified protein supports muscle hypertrophy, strength, and potential anti-aging properties. However, its therapeutic uses remain under rigorous scientific evaluation.

Igf 1 lr3 dosage protocol

IGF-1 LR3, or Insulin-like Growth Factor 1 Long R3, is a modified version of IGF-1 used in bodybuilding for muscle growth and recovery. The dosage varies by individual goals and tolerance, often ranging from 20 to 50 mcg per day. Beginners should start low to minimize side effects, with cycles lasting 4-6 weeks. It’s essential to consult healthcare professionals before use.
